Fee reductions for micro-enterprises from April

19.03.2024

The European Patent Office (EPO) is to create an incentive package to help the filing of European patent applications by reducing payment fees

This incentive package aims to help smaller, less experienced European organisations grow and develop by giving them easier access to the European patent system.

From 1 April, a 30% reduction will be applied to:

  • official filing fees
  • prior art search fees
  • examination application fees
  • Member State designation fees 
  • grant fee
  • patent application annuity fees, provided the applicant has filed fewer than five patent applications in the last five years.

These incentives are aimed at micro-enterprises, universities, non-profit organisations, public research institutions and individuals.

In order to be entitled to these reductions, the status of one of the above types of entity must be filled in on the European patent application form.
